**Vendor note: Inkmill markdown pipeline**

Rendering for Parchway docs is outsourced to Inkmill under an annual contract, renewing each March. They handle sanitization and PDF export; we own the upload queue. SLA: 4-hour response on rendering failures. Escalate only after two failed retries. Their support desk is reachable at the address below.

billing contact of hahaf-baguf = zorael.tammir.jorius@sivrelhq.internal

Handover — Queuewright autoscaler. Contractor onboarding, keep it short. The scaler polls queue depth every 15s and adjusts worker pods on the Brindlehook cluster. Don't touch the cooldown logic; Marek tuned it after the June thrash incident. Alerts route to the on-call rotation, not you. Scale bounds live in config. The current production values are as follows.

deployment values, yahag-tawef:
ZORWYN_HOST=zorwyn.tolvaqlabs.internal
ZORWYN_PORT=9300

- Show the new starter the bike cage behind the Fennick Row building and the staff parking gates on Alder Court. Cage is card-access only after 19:00; gates close at 22:00 sharp. Register their vehicle with the facilities inbox first. Both the cage and the gates accept the code below.

staff pass of kawip-hawef = bdg-QLP-2

Ticket: Staging env misconfigured for Siftgate bloom filter

The bloom layer in front of the Pellet KV store is rejecting all lookups in staging because the env file was copied from the dev template without credentials. False-positive tuning values are fine; only the auth line is missing. To unblock the weekly demo, the Pellet admission secret must be set on the following line.

env line for yaguf-fajop: LEDGER_TOKEN13=fb08984397349